Yes, androsterone should also be able to raise DHT not only because it is a precursor but because it competes with DHT for the 3a-HSD enzyme. That enzyme degrades DHT, so by taking androsterone you basically prevent it from degrading DHT. So, androsterone has a dual DHT-boosting effect which is probably shared by other steroids like 5a-DHP and even allopregnanolone but those are less effective as DHT precursors so androsterone is the top choice. Here's a paper I had forgotten about:

Inhibiting COX-2 In Senescent Rat Leydig Cells Restores Testosterone Synthesis

<<Although multiple factors have been reported to be involved in the age-associated decrease in blood testosterone (1, 2, 9), it appears that the primary site for this decrease is testosterone biosynthesis in aging Leydig cells (1, 10). The rate-limiting step in testosterone biosynthesis is the transfer of the substrate cholesterol to the mitochondrial inner membrane, thereby initiating the steroidogenic process (11). We previously demonstrated that the steroidogenic acute regulatory (StAR) protein plays a critical function in this step by facilitating cholesterol transfer to the mitochondrial inner membrane (12–14). However, StAR protein also declines during Leydig cell aging, and the process of mitochondrial cholesterol transfer in aged Leydig cells is defective (15–17). Therefore, the mechanism regulating the age-related decline in StAR gene expression becomes an important consideration in elucidating the decline in testosterone biosynthesis during male aging.

...In summary, our results indicate that a COX2-dependent tonic inhibition of StAR gene expression is involved in the regulation of the steroidogenic sensitivity of Leydig cells to LH or cAMP stimulation.>>​

The StAR protein transfers cholesterol into the Leydig cells where it can be synthesized into steroids. So, inhibiting COX2, by increasing the expression of StAR, should also increase the amount of PREG produced in the testis. Following this logic it would seem that even a temporary course of high-dose aspirin can be useful for stabilizing the organism in times of acute stress, since the interruption of steroidogenesis can cause a vicious cycle.
